Benzyl Acetate from Japan

Benzyl acetate is an aromatic ester of acetic acid and benzyl alcohol, featuring a jasmine-like scent used extensively in soaps, detergents, and floral perfumes. Under HTS 2915.39.31.00 as an 'other' aromatic acetic acid ester described in additional U.S. note 3 to section VI. It is a pure, chemically defined compound per Chapter 29 definitions.
